Dinosaur Bone Fragment - Fossil Specimen ammonite fossil morocco more concentrated style of CongoMined from: Morrison Formation, Utah, U. S. A. Era: Mesozoic Geological Age: 155148 mya Description: This one of a kind dinosaur bone fragment from Utah has a dark polished face with deep black, charcoal, burgundy red, brown, and grey mineral areas. The preserved bone cell structure is visible in patches across the surface, while the rough outer edges keep the piece looking natural and fossil forward instead of overly finished.
